Research paper thumbnail of Determination of thorium isotopes in mineral and environmental water and soil samples by α-spectrometry and the fate of thorium in water

Applied Radiation and Isotopes, 2008

A method has been developed for determination of thorium isotopes in water and soil samples by a-... more A method has been developed for determination of thorium isotopes in water and soil samples by a-spectrometry. After fusion with Na 2 CO 3 and Na 2 O 2 at 600 1C, soil samples were leached with HNO 3 and HCl. Thorium in water sample or in soil leaching solution was coprecipitated together with iron (III) as hydroxides and/or carbonates at pH 9 with ammonia solution, separated from uranium and other a-emitters by a Microthene-TOPO (tri-octyl-phosphine oxide) chromatographic column, electrodeposited on a stainless steel disk, and measured by a-spectrometry. The method was checked with two certified reference materials supplied by the IAEA, and reliable results were obtained. The detection limits of the method for water (soil) samples are 0.44 mBq l À1 (0.070 Bq kg À1 ) for 232 Th, 0.80 mBq l À1 (0.13 Bq kg À1 ) for 230 Th and 1.0 mBq l À1 (0.16 Bq kg À1 ) for 228 Th, respectively, if 100 l of water (0.50 g) for each sample are analysed. A variety of water or soil samples were analysed using this procedure and giving average thorium yields of 75.5714.2% for water and 93.474.5% for soil. The obtained concentrations of thorium isotopes in water samples are in the range of 0.0007-0.0326 mBq l À1 for 232 Th, p0.0008-0.0258 mBq l À1 for 230 Th and 0.0014-1.32 mBq l À1 for 228 Th. The 230 Th/ 232 Th and 228 Th/ 232 Th ratios are in the range of p0.57-3.9 and 1.06-717, respectively. The disequilibrium between 232 Th and 228 Th activity in water is observed and the fate of thorium isotopes in water was studied. The exposure impact due to intake of thorium in the analysed drinking water was evaluated, showing a negligible amount of dose contribution. The concentrations of 232 Th, 230 Th and 228 Th in the analysed soil samples are in the range of 30.2-48.6, 32.5-60.5 and 31.0-53.0 Bq kg À1 , respectively. The obtained mean ratio is 1.0470.05 for 228 Th/ 232 Th and 1.2070.41 for 230 Th/ 232 Th.

Research paper thumbnail of A methodological approach for sediment core dating

Radioprotection, 2002

A methodological procedure to date sediment cores by gamma measure of 2l0 Pb is proposed. This pr... more A methodological procedure to date sediment cores by gamma measure of 2l0 Pb is proposed. This procedure includes the self-absorption correction, experimentally obtained, and the sediment core dating, by software computation. Selection of detector type, sample container and measurement configuration are discussed. In the paper measurement corrections for core slices with very low content of sediment, with respect to the volume of reference calibration source, are also discussed. The method has been validated performing a comparison with two reference materials. As conclusion, the application of the procedure to sediment core coming from Venice lagoon is showed.

Research paper thumbnail of Radiometric characterisation of more representative natural building materials in the province of Rome

Radiation Protection Dosimetry, 2004

Natural building materials, characterised by middle-low-activity concentrations of primordial rad... more Natural building materials, characterised by middle-low-activity concentrations of primordial radionuclides ( 40 K, 232 Th and 238 U series) are widely used in Italy. Since natural materials reflect the geological variability of their sites of origin, a systematic study was carried out in the province of Rome and the results are reported in this paper. In the present work, in order to evaluate average, minimum and maximum contents of primordial radionuclides, more representative lithologies outcropping on the territory of the province of Rome were identified and around 150 samples were collected. Also, these lithologies were characterised from a radioprotection point of view, by means of the evaluation of the index, I, when they are used as building materials. The results confirm the high-primordial radionuclide content within some materials used in Latium (central Italy). Although the study was carried out in a limited area, the results confirm considerable variation in the primordial radionuclide content depending on the sites of origin. Ã

Research paper thumbnail of Analysis of Process Variables via CFD to Evaluate the Performance of a FCC Riser

International Journal of Chemical Engineering, 2015

Feedstock conversion and yield products are studied through a 3D model simulating the main reacto... more Feedstock conversion and yield products are studied through a 3D model simulating the main reactor of the fluid catalytic cracking (FCC) process. Computational fluid dynamic (CFD) is used with Eulerian-Eulerian approach to predict the fluid catalytic cracking behavior. The model considers 12 lumps with catalyst deactivation by coke and poisoning by alkaline nitrides and polycyclic aromatic adsorption to estimate the kinetic behavior which, starting from a given feedstock, produces several cracking products. Different feedstock compositions are considered. The model is compared with sampling data at industrial operation conditions. The simulation model is able to represent accurately the products behavior for the different operating conditions considered. All the conditions considered were solved using a solver ANSYS CFX 14.0. The different operation process variables and hydrodynamic effects of the industrial riser of a fluid catalytic cracking (FCC) are evaluated. Predictions from the model are shown and comparison with experimental conversion and yields products are presented; recommendations are drawn to establish the conditions to obtain higher product yields in the industrial process.
